// TILE_PREFETCH_RADIUS controls how many rings of adjacent
// map tiles the Cartovane prefetcher pulls around the viewport.
// Security note: values above 4 were rejected in review because
// they let a client trigger amplified upstream fetches — a cheap
// request fanning out to hundreds of tile origins. Keep this
// constant at 3 unless the rate limiter in fetchguard.go is
// updated in the same change. Any bump must cite the benchmark
// run whose token appears below.

trace token, fafog-kageg: htk4_98e6

## Formula sandbox tuning

User-supplied formulas in Gridmoor execute inside a restricted interpreter with hard ceilings on time, memory, and call depth. Reviewers should confirm any change to these ceilings is justified in the PR description, since raising them widens the abuse surface. Defaults were chosen from production traces. The current limits are as follows.

limits module of tafog-fawip:
WEIGHTS = {
    "julix": 57,
    "lamys": 992,
    "kasvan": 209,
    "quenok": 750,
    "alddor": 259,
    "oliath": 1009,
    "wenix": 815,
}

**09:14** — Orders placed after the Crumbelle bakery cutoff (06:00 local) were still accepted due to a timezone bug in the cutoff rule. 37 orders affected. Hotfix deployed 09:41. Fulfillment manually reconciled by 10:15. Root cause: naive datetime comparison. Fix verified in staging; the deployed build token follows below.

pipeline stamp: htk9_6ce9d33c5